TheCroatia national under-15 football team representsCroatia in internationalfootball matches for players aged 15 or younger. It is governed by theCroatian Football Federation, the governing body forfootball in Croatia. It is a member ofUEFA in Europe andFIFA in global competitions. The team's colours reference two national symbols: theCroatian checkerboard and thecountry's tricolour. They are colloquially referred to as theMali vatreni ('Little Blazers'). TheMali vatreni participate in theUEFA Under-15 Development Tournaments, ending up as runners-up in the 2023 tournament in Croatia, its first competition in the tournament so far. Other than that, the team competes inVlatko Marković International Tournament established by the HNS in 2019. The team won the tournament three times, in 2021, 2022 and 2023.
